Introduction

The Paleo-Hebrew (Paleo meaning “old”) alphabet, also called Phoenecian has an

unknown origin. How it started and who started it has different theories. This book

is about my theory as to the meaning of each letter.

The names are based upon pictorial matches with the Greek Alphabet. The

names are therefore assigned, so as to identify them. Originally there is no evidence

to suggest the Paleo-Hebrew Alphabet had names. The letters LMD and LMBD

are pretty much the same, since LMD is unique to Paleo-Hebrew and LMBD is a

pictorial match to the Greek letter Lambda. LMD is traditionally a phonetic match

to Lambda; the „L‟, whereas LMBD is traditionally named Gimel, so it appears that

either LMD was a different phoneme or more likely the Paleo-Hebrew Alphabet did

not have phonemes, at least in the beginning.

It is well known that Paleo-Hebrew did not have vowels, at least. It was the Greeks

that added vowels to their alphabet, so again the Paleo-Alphabets may not have been

a spoken language. It may have been due to the popularity of the Alphabet that

resulted in the need to attach phonemes to them. My book, The Origins of the

Paleo-Hebrew Vocabulary A New Theory, explains how the vocabulary is derived.

The main theory I work off of is that the Alphabet is primarily pictographs with

ideographic meaning when combined with each other into a vocabulary.

My discovery of the Paleo-Hebrew Alphabet was that each letter corresponded to

a different Egyptian Hieratic character than the tradition has said it is. It was the

Egyptian God Re in Paleo-Hebrew from which I made my discovery. Knowing the

correct picture representations is the keystone to the whole language. With the

correct Egyptian Hieratic characters I then identified that an Egyptian Deity also

corresponded to each Paleo-Hebrew letter.
